

A beloved mother, grandmother, sister, and friend, she passed away peacefully on November 24th, 2025 at the age of 95. She was surrounded by the love of her family in Loveland, Colorado.
Born on September 8th, 1930 in Decatur, Iowa, she was the daughter of Lester Grant Evans and Dorothy K. (Carlson) Evans . From a young age, she carried a gentle strength, a nurturing spirit, and a deep devotion to those she loved.
She married Harold Smith on December 24, 1950 and together they built a home filled with laughter, homemade meals, and the warmth of family traditions. She was the proud mother of Douglas Lee, Patricia Ann, Michael Wayne and Michelle Lynn. She was also the cherished grandmother of Peter J. Smith, Mindy Smith, Laura Enoch, Joe Puch, Angelica (Puch) Schreiber, Michael Hillenberg, Ian Simkins, Rebbeca (Smith) Wild, Amanda Smith, John Smith, Alese Mullen and Ethan Mullen. Each of whom brought her endless joy.
Throughout her life, she was known for her career with Safeway, but it was her sweetness, patience, and unwavering support that truly defined her. She had a gift for making everyone feel welcome—whether through her famous chili suppers, Christmas celebrations, her comforting hugs, or her ability to listen without judgment.
She enjoyed hobbies such as gardening, crafting, scrapbooking, calligraphy, reading, sewing and bowling and she shared her talents generously with family, friends, and the community. Her home was always a place of comfort, where holidays were magical and ordinary days felt special. She left no one out, her home, her table, and her heart were always open. Thelma loved traveling and made many friends along the way. Among them were her beloved neighbors, Sharon and Mike Perry who stood by her with kindness, laughter, and unwavering friendship.
She is survived by her children Doug Smith (Kathy), Michael Smith, and Michelle Mullen, twelve grandchildren and many great grandchildren, and by her sister Anne Hollesen. She is preceded in death by her husband Harold Milton Smith, daughter Patricia Puch, siblings Everett Evans, Junior Smith, Eileen Henderson, Pauline Pfab and Martha Joines and great grandson Ryder Wild. Though she will be deeply missed, her legacy of love, strength, and family togetherness will live on through the countless lives she touched.
A Celebration of Thelma's Life will be held on December 5th, 2025 at 11:00am at Resthaven Funeral Home & Memory Gardens in Fort Collins, Colorado. Burial and reception to follow.
In lieu of flowers, the family asks that donations be made to Pathways Hospice. The family extends their heartfelt thanks to Thelma’s caregivers for their compassionate care.
